New school playground equipment upgrades opened in Cremona

New playground equipment, which cost about $75,000, includes slides, climbing elements and spinners, replaces an out-of-date one

CREMONA — Officials held a grand opening of upgraded playground at Cremona School during the school 's Back to School BBQ on Sept. 5.

Members of the Cremona School Enhancement Society, the Cremona Lions and Mountain View County officially opened a new playground at the Cremona School.

The playground was funded by donations including from the Village of Cremona in the amount of $5,000. Mountain View County donated $20,000 and Cremona Lions donated $10,000.

School principal Darryl Korody explained that the new playground upgrade, which includes slides, climbing elements and spinners, replaces out-of-date equipment.

“The kids love it,” Korody told the Albertan. “When we opened it the kids ran for it and are giving it rave reviews. And I’ve heard that from the parents too.”

The total cost of the project was about $75,000, he said.
